The Gay Defender
"A tale of New Spain, of cracking whips, of swishing crinoline, or bold Americanos, and dashing Dons."
Originally released in 1927. The Gay Defender is a drama/western film. directed by Gregory La Cava. At just 70 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Thelma Todd, Richard Dix, and Fred Kohler
Synopsis
Real-life outlaw Joaquin Murietta, who (according to this film, anyway) is a latter-day Robin Hood, dedicated to driving land-grabbers and corrupt politicians out of Spanish California.
